Vikara Village is an emerging nonprofit organization offering healing yoga and arts to help develop a healthy sense of self, community and belonging. Vikara Village uses the communal spirit of yoga and the arts to empower individuals to reach their full potential.
We are looking for individuals who understand and are committed to Vikara Village’s mission and core values to join our Advisory Committee as we grow and move our mission forward.
Because we are a small, up-and-coming nonprofit, our Committee Members have the opportunity to be fully involved and are very hands-on with our program. If you're looking for Board service that goes beyond the conference room, this is a great fit!
We are open to diverse individuals ready to commit time and energy towards our mission. We are especially seeking those with experience and/or interest in:
- fundraising
- understanding of systems
- social media
- communications or marketing
- organizational skills
- governance
- experience with product and/or program management
- previous Board of Director experience

Mission Statement
Vikara Village's mission is to use the communal spirit of yoga and the arts to empower individuals to reach their full potential.
Description
Vikara Village uses the communal spirit of yoga and the arts to empower individuals to reach their full potential. Our primary focus is working with middle and high school aged youth with developing skills for:
- goal-setting
- problem-solving
- building positive relationships within their community
- increasing self-esteem
- increasing community involvement
Our programs, combine yoga exploration and the arts with goal-setting, self-esteem building and relaxation techniques to help youth develop more positive relationships and healthy decision-making skills.
